The Problem of Institutionalisation: Everyday is one too many
We do not wish to abolish childcare institutions in Malaysia. But unfortunately, being raised in a non-family based environment comes with many harmful effects.
Deinstitutionalisation: Moving from Institutions to Family and Community Based Care
The mission to end the institutionalisation of children is a journey that should be embraced in hopes that we can eventually have a larger positive community for everyone.
